Application of environmental monitoring and forecasting systems in transport

The impacts of road transport on the environment are of growing concern in most developed countries and New Zealand is no exception; two of the primary areas of concern in New Zealand being the effects of vehicle emissions, and noise. A key focus area of the New Zealand Transport Strategy is on reducing the impacts of transport on the environment, and in particular where this affects public health. The purpose of this research project was to review the use overseas of environmental monitoring and forecasting systems as a component of wider integrated ITS facilities; in particular those linked to active traffic management systems, and related information systems, and to consider the potential for the use of these systems in New Zealand. This paper provides a summary of the larger study. (a)
